Opinion
DISMISS and Opinion Filed September 12, 2022
In The Court of Appeals Fifth District of Texas at Dallas No. 05-22-00887-CV
IN RE ALEX NEAL, Relator
Original Proceeding from the 296th Judicial District Court Collin County, Texas Trial Court Cause No. 296-82970-2022
MEMORANDUM OPINION Before Justices Molberg, Pedersen, III, and Garcia Opinion by Justice Pedersen, III Before the Court is Alex Neal’s September 7, 2022 “Writ of Habeas Corpus.”
We construe this filing as an original petition for writ of habeas corpus. In his
petition, Neal contends that a true bill of indictment contains numerous errors, that
the indictment has been wrongfully duplicated nine times, and that he is innocent.
This Court does not have original jurisdiction to consider petitions seeking
habeas relief generated in connection with criminal proceedings. See TEX. GOV’T
CODE ANN. § 22.221(d); TEX. CODE CRIM. PROC. art. 11.05; In re Spriggs, 528
S.W.3d 234, 236 (Tex. App.—Amarillo 2017, orig. proceeding); In re Ayers, 515
S.W.3d 356, 356–57 (Tex. App.—Houston [14th Dist.] 2016, orig. proceeding) (per curiam); see also In re Dingler, Nos. 05-22-00594-CV, 05-22-00595-CV, 05-22-
00596-CV, 05-22-00597-CV, 2022 WL 2302173, at *1 (Tex. App.—Dallas June 27,
2022, orig. proceeding) (mem. op.).
We dismiss relator’s original petition for writ of habeas corpus for want of
jurisdiction.
